My question is- how do you know the battery was fully charged? You would need to check it without it being plugged into your house power- either with a multi meter or, better yet, a hydrometer. At any rate- I don't know how the boxes are configured on that year of trailer but is there may be a way you can directly "jump" the hydraulic raising mechanism if that is accessible with the top down. On mine- I CAN raise the battery door enough to expose those components and get cables on them in a pinch. Rick |
